Lorenz Brun | c88c82d | 2020-05-08 14:35:04 +0200 | [diff] [blame^] | 1 | Copyright 2020 The Monogon Project Authors. |
| 2 | |
| 3 | Licensed under the Apache License, Version 2.0 (the "License"); |
| 4 | you may not use this file except in compliance with the License. |
| 5 | You may obtain a copy of the License at |
| 6 | |
| 7 | http://www.apache.org/licenses/LICENSE-2.0 |
| 8 | |
| 9 | Unless required by applicable law or agreed to in writing, software |
| 10 | distributed under the License is distributed on an "AS IS" BASIS, |
| 11 | W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. |
| 12 | See the License for the specific language governing permissions and |
| 13 | limitations under the License. |
| 14 | |
| 15 | |
| 16 | From d92dc4195d4de5149e7e55890fa856837a35217e Mon Sep 17 00:00:00 2001 |
| 17 | From: Lorenz Brun <lorenz@brun.one> |
| 18 | Date: Mon, 4 May 2020 15:33:40 +0200 |
| 19 | Subject: [PATCH] Reflect code patches in Bazel and build pure |
| 20 | |
| 21 | --- |
| 22 | cmd/containerd-shim-runsc-v1/BUILD.bazel | 1 + |
| 23 | cmd/gvisor-containerd-shim/BUILD.bazel | 4 ++-- |
| 24 | pkg/v1/proc/BUILD.bazel | 3 ++- |
| 25 | pkg/v1/shim/BUILD.bazel | 5 +++-- |
| 26 | pkg/v2/BUILD.bazel | 14 ++++++++------ |
| 27 | 5 files changed, 16 insertions(+), 11 deletions(-) |
| 28 | |
| 29 | diff --git a/cmd/containerd-shim-runsc-v1/BUILD.bazel b/cmd/containerd-shim-runsc-v1/BUILD.bazel |
| 30 | index 8fb6a86..d58f069 100644 |
| 31 | --- a/cmd/containerd-shim-runsc-v1/BUILD.bazel |
| 32 | +++ b/cmd/containerd-shim-runsc-v1/BUILD.bazel |
| 33 | @@ -14,5 +14,6 @@ go_library( |
| 34 | go_binary( |
| 35 | name = "containerd-shim-runsc-v1", |
| 36 | embed = [":go_default_library"], |
| 37 | + pure = "on", |
| 38 | visibility = ["//visibility:public"], |
| 39 | ) |
| 40 | diff --git a/cmd/gvisor-containerd-shim/BUILD.bazel b/cmd/gvisor-containerd-shim/BUILD.bazel |
| 41 | index 8478746..f6a6fa2 100644 |
| 42 | --- a/cmd/gvisor-containerd-shim/BUILD.bazel |
| 43 | +++ b/cmd/gvisor-containerd-shim/BUILD.bazel |
| 44 | @@ -14,9 +14,9 @@ go_library( |
| 45 | "@com_github_burntsushi_toml//:go_default_library", |
| 46 | "@com_github_containerd_containerd//events:go_default_library", |
| 47 | "@com_github_containerd_containerd//namespaces:go_default_library", |
| 48 | - "@com_github_containerd_containerd//runtime/v1/linux/proc:go_default_library", |
| 49 | - "@com_github_containerd_containerd//runtime/v1/shim:go_default_library", |
| 50 | + "@com_github_containerd_containerd//pkg/process:go_default_library", |
| 51 | "@com_github_containerd_containerd//runtime/v1/shim/v1:go_default_library", |
| 52 | + "@com_github_containerd_containerd//sys/reaper:go_default_library", |
| 53 | "@com_github_containerd_ttrpc//:go_default_library", |
| 54 | "@com_github_containerd_typeurl//:go_default_library", |
| 55 | "@com_github_gogo_protobuf//types:go_default_library", |
| 56 | diff --git a/pkg/v1/proc/BUILD.bazel b/pkg/v1/proc/BUILD.bazel |
| 57 | index 8ef457c..1bf9228 100644 |
| 58 | --- a/pkg/v1/proc/BUILD.bazel |
| 59 | +++ b/pkg/v1/proc/BUILD.bazel |
| 60 | @@ -21,7 +21,8 @@ go_library( |
| 61 | "@com_github_containerd_containerd//errdefs:go_default_library", |
| 62 | "@com_github_containerd_containerd//log:go_default_library", |
| 63 | "@com_github_containerd_containerd//mount:go_default_library", |
| 64 | - "@com_github_containerd_containerd//runtime/proc:go_default_library", |
| 65 | + "@com_github_containerd_containerd//pkg/process:go_default_library", |
| 66 | + "@com_github_containerd_containerd//pkg/stdio:go_default_library", |
| 67 | "@com_github_containerd_fifo//:go_default_library", |
| 68 | "@com_github_containerd_go_runc//:go_default_library", |
| 69 | "@com_github_gogo_protobuf//types:go_default_library", |
| 70 | diff --git a/pkg/v1/shim/BUILD.bazel b/pkg/v1/shim/BUILD.bazel |
| 71 | index a5d83c4..2129cd8 100644 |
| 72 | --- a/pkg/v1/shim/BUILD.bazel |
| 73 | +++ b/pkg/v1/shim/BUILD.bazel |
| 74 | @@ -20,11 +20,12 @@ go_library( |
| 75 | "@com_github_containerd_containerd//log:go_default_library", |
| 76 | "@com_github_containerd_containerd//mount:go_default_library", |
| 77 | "@com_github_containerd_containerd//namespaces:go_default_library", |
| 78 | + "@com_github_containerd_containerd//pkg/process:go_default_library", |
| 79 | + "@com_github_containerd_containerd//pkg/stdio:go_default_library", |
| 80 | "@com_github_containerd_containerd//runtime:go_default_library", |
| 81 | "@com_github_containerd_containerd//runtime/linux/runctypes:go_default_library", |
| 82 | - "@com_github_containerd_containerd//runtime/proc:go_default_library", |
| 83 | - "@com_github_containerd_containerd//runtime/v1/shim:go_default_library", |
| 84 | "@com_github_containerd_containerd//runtime/v1/shim/v1:go_default_library", |
| 85 | + "@com_github_containerd_containerd//sys/reaper:go_default_library", |
| 86 | "@com_github_containerd_fifo//:go_default_library", |
| 87 | "@com_github_containerd_typeurl//:go_default_library", |
| 88 | "@com_github_gogo_protobuf//types:go_default_library", |
| 89 | diff --git a/pkg/v2/BUILD.bazel b/pkg/v2/BUILD.bazel |
| 90 | index a7a6abb..d61b785 100644 |
| 91 | --- a/pkg/v2/BUILD.bazel |
| 92 | +++ b/pkg/v2/BUILD.bazel |
| 93 | @@ -16,20 +16,21 @@ go_library( |
| 94 | "//pkg/v1/utils:go_default_library", |
| 95 | "//pkg/v2/options:go_default_library", |
| 96 | "@com_github_burntsushi_toml//:go_default_library", |
| 97 | - "@com_github_containerd_cgroups//:go_default_library", |
| 98 | + "@com_github_containerd_cgroups//stats/v1:go_default_library", |
| 99 | "@com_github_containerd_console//:go_default_library", |
| 100 | "@com_github_containerd_containerd//api/events:go_default_library", |
| 101 | "@com_github_containerd_containerd//api/types/task:go_default_library", |
| 102 | "@com_github_containerd_containerd//errdefs:go_default_library", |
| 103 | - "@com_github_containerd_containerd//events:go_default_library", |
| 104 | "@com_github_containerd_containerd//log:go_default_library", |
| 105 | "@com_github_containerd_containerd//mount:go_default_library", |
| 106 | "@com_github_containerd_containerd//namespaces:go_default_library", |
| 107 | + "@com_github_containerd_containerd//pkg/process:go_default_library", |
| 108 | + "@com_github_containerd_containerd//pkg/stdio:go_default_library", |
| 109 | "@com_github_containerd_containerd//runtime:go_default_library", |
| 110 | "@com_github_containerd_containerd//runtime/linux/runctypes:go_default_library", |
| 111 | - "@com_github_containerd_containerd//runtime/proc:go_default_library", |
| 112 | "@com_github_containerd_containerd//runtime/v2/shim:go_default_library", |
| 113 | "@com_github_containerd_containerd//runtime/v2/task:go_default_library", |
| 114 | + "@com_github_containerd_containerd//sys/reaper:go_default_library", |
| 115 | "@com_github_containerd_cri//pkg/api/runtimeoptions/v1:go_default_library", |
| 116 | "@com_github_containerd_fifo//:go_default_library", |
| 117 | "@com_github_containerd_typeurl//:go_default_library", |
| 118 | @@ -44,20 +45,21 @@ go_library( |
| 119 | "//pkg/v1/utils:go_default_library", |
| 120 | "//pkg/v2/options:go_default_library", |
| 121 | "@com_github_burntsushi_toml//:go_default_library", |
| 122 | - "@com_github_containerd_cgroups//:go_default_library", |
| 123 | + "@com_github_containerd_cgroups//stats/v1:go_default_library", |
| 124 | "@com_github_containerd_console//:go_default_library", |
| 125 | "@com_github_containerd_containerd//api/events:go_default_library", |
| 126 | "@com_github_containerd_containerd//api/types/task:go_default_library", |
| 127 | "@com_github_containerd_containerd//errdefs:go_default_library", |
| 128 | - "@com_github_containerd_containerd//events:go_default_library", |
| 129 | "@com_github_containerd_containerd//log:go_default_library", |
| 130 | "@com_github_containerd_containerd//mount:go_default_library", |
| 131 | "@com_github_containerd_containerd//namespaces:go_default_library", |
| 132 | + "@com_github_containerd_containerd//pkg/process:go_default_library", |
| 133 | + "@com_github_containerd_containerd//pkg/stdio:go_default_library", |
| 134 | "@com_github_containerd_containerd//runtime:go_default_library", |
| 135 | "@com_github_containerd_containerd//runtime/linux/runctypes:go_default_library", |
| 136 | - "@com_github_containerd_containerd//runtime/proc:go_default_library", |
| 137 | "@com_github_containerd_containerd//runtime/v2/shim:go_default_library", |
| 138 | "@com_github_containerd_containerd//runtime/v2/task:go_default_library", |
| 139 | + "@com_github_containerd_containerd//sys/reaper:go_default_library", |
| 140 | "@com_github_containerd_cri//pkg/api/runtimeoptions/v1:go_default_library", |
| 141 | "@com_github_containerd_fifo//:go_default_library", |
| 142 | "@com_github_containerd_typeurl//:go_default_library", |
| 143 | -- |
| 144 | 2.25.1 |
| 145 | |